What Do You Want to Find?
Manufacturers of the metal detectors usually produce all-purpose metal detectors for buyers to find just anything they could want. However, there is a need to consider your personal needs before making a purchase decision. Perhaps you are having an adventure or searching for art crafts and treasure caches; you need to consider specific metal detectors that can specifically help you with your goals. Ensure the metal detector is designed particularly to pinpoint what you need. Such metal detectors can be easy to use and tune to fit your requirements. You also need to check the frequency and sensitivity to help you detect the specific metals you want.
Your Experience
Your experience with metal detection matters a lot when making a purchase decision for the best metal detector. However, do not worry if you have no experience yet because there is probably the most modern metal detectors for beginners. Minding about your experience will help you in selecting a metal detector with the best tuning and calibrator for the types of metals you need. If you are an experienced user, you will need a metal detector with in-depth features that will guarantee excellent findings in your search. For the beginners, metal detectors with an automatic tuner and quick start settings can be the best choice for you.

The Weight
Always consider a metal detector that is easy to carry around the detecting area. If you are planning to carry your metal detector for long hours, you will obviously need a lightweight product that will not make you too tired of moving it. With the appropriate weight for your metal detector, you will have an enjoyable activity for sure.
